For those of you that don’t know, a noise-canceling microphone is a type of microphone that can easily disable ambient noises. This allows it to only record whatever is spoken right at it. This makes them pretty handy in quite a number of activities. These include:
  • Call center headsets
  • Helicopter pilot headsets
  • Racecar driver headsets
  • Shipboard communications
  • Video gaming Headsets
Without going into technical details as to how ambient noise cancelation works, suffice it to say that these microphones are great to use in noisy environments.
